Undefeated former Olympic champion Guillermo Rigondeaux (11-0 with 8 KOs) of Cuba said he is very confident of overcoming unified 122-pound Filipino champ Nonito Donaire (31-1, 20 KOs) on April 13 in New York. Rigondeaux feels disrespected by some of the recent comments that came from Donaire and his trainer Robert Garcia.
"Nonito doesn't really know a true double Olympic champion. He better be well be prepared, because on April 13 I'm going to [hit him with] him a lot of leather. He has not fought anybody. He faced a group of dead men, and I'm able to knock out all of them in one day," Rigondeaux told The Zone Radio
